Google Home can answer two-part contextual questions

It is therefore logical that Google Home answers questions because Google and research go hand in hand. The brain of Google Home however goes beyond simple demands. According to a Google spokesperson, the device recognizes two commands in one sentence and executes them. "For example," Hey Google, play Thanks then and set the volume to 50 percent," the spokesman says. Although both devices try to answer two-part questions like this, it is more likely that Alexa answers with "Sorry, I do not know how to answer that question", compared to Google Home, Blank adds. .

Google Home can easily centralize control of other smart devices

Through the action of Google Assistant, users can directly control more intelligent devices with only their voice. That includes robot vacuums, lamps, smart plugs and switches, and even mops, according to the eufy product team, a smart home brand. But with Alexa devices, users need to add custom skills to make this possible – by adding an extra step for some users. Google Home can understand multiple languages

Google Home is multilingual, which means that you can speak to the speaker in different languages ​​interchangeably. "We were able to do this with our advances in voice recognition technology," said a spokesman for Google.
